Start With Your Wedding Vision and Budget

The first step in wedding planning is understanding what kind of celebration you want. Before booking anything, discuss your wedding vision with your partner and family.
Decide whether you want:
- A grand traditional wedding
- A destination wedding
- An intimate celebration
- A modern luxury wedding
- A themed wedding event
Once you have a clear idea, create a realistic wedding budget. Divide your expenses into categories such as venue, catering, décor, photography, outfits, entertainment, invitations, accommodation, and transportation.
A planned budget helps you prioritize important elements and prevents unnecessary spending during the wedding preparations.
Finalize the Wedding Date and Guest List

Choosing the wedding date is one of the earliest decisions you need to make. Consider family availability, weather, wedding season, and venue availability before finalizing the date.
After selecting the date, prepare an approximate guest list. Your guest count will influence almost every wedding decision, especially:
- Venue size
- Catering requirements
- Seating arrangements
- Décor planning
- Accommodation needs
A realistic guest list helps you choose a venue that feels comfortable and well-organized.
Choose and Book Your Wedding Venue

The wedding venue is one of the biggest decisions because it becomes the backdrop for your entire celebration. From décor possibilities to guest experience, the venue impacts the overall look and feel of your wedding.
When selecting a venue, consider:
- Location and accessibility
- Guest capacity
- Parking facilities
- Indoor or outdoor setup
- Weather backup options
- Catering services
- Décor flexibility
- Budget
Popular wedding venue options include banquet halls, luxury hotels, resorts, farmhouses, rooftop spaces, and destination venues.

Hire Important Wedding Vendors

Once your venue is finalized, start booking your major wedding vendors. Popular vendors often get booked months in advance, especially during peak wedding seasons.
Important vendors include:
Wedding Photographer and Videographer:
Your wedding photographs and videos preserve memories for years, so choose professionals whose style matches your vision. Review portfolios, packages, and previous work before making a decision.
Caterer:
Food is one of the most memorable parts of any wedding. Plan your menu based on guest preferences, cuisines, and your wedding style. Schedule tastings before finalizing the caterer.
Decorator:
Your décor creates the atmosphere of your wedding. Discuss your theme, color palette, floral arrangements, stage design, lighting, and overall setup.
Makeup Artist and Styling Team:
Book bridal makeup artists, hairstylists, and grooming professionals early to ensure availability.
Decide Your Wedding Theme and Décor Style

A wedding theme helps create a consistent look across all elements of your celebration.
Some popular wedding décor styles include:
- Royal palace-inspired themes
- Minimal modern décor
- Floral garden setups
- Pastel wedding themes
- Luxury editorial-style décor
- Traditional Indian wedding décor
Choose colors, flowers, lighting, and decorative elements that match your personality and venue.
A well-planned décor theme can transform even a simple venue into a stunning wedding space.
Plan Wedding Outfits and Jewellery

Wedding outfits require time for selection, customization, and fittings. Start planning your outfits early to avoid last-minute stress.
Plan:
- Bridal lehenga or wedding outfit
- Groom’s attire
- Jewellery
- Shoes and accessories
- Family outfits
Consider your wedding theme and venue while choosing your outfits. For example, royal venues pair beautifully with traditional outfits, while modern venues may complement contemporary styles.
Organize Wedding Functions and Schedule

Indian weddings often include multiple celebrations, each with its own planning requirements.
Common wedding functions include:
- Engagement ceremony
- Mehendi function
- Haldi ceremony
- Sangeet night
- Wedding ceremony
- Reception
Create a timeline for each event, including:
- Venue setup time
- Vendor arrival
- Guest arrival
- Ceremony timings
- Entertainment schedule
A clear schedule helps everyone stay coordinated.
Plan Guest Experience and Accommodation

A memorable wedding is not only about décor and celebrations—it is also about making guests comfortable.
Plan:
- Guest accommodation
- Transportation
- Welcome arrangements
- Food preferences
- Special requirements
For guests traveling from different cities, arranging hotels and transport in advance makes their experience smoother.
Finalize Invitations and Wedding Communication

Once the major details are confirmed, prepare your wedding invitations.
You can choose:
- Traditional printed invitations
- Digital invitations
- Personalized wedding websites
Make sure invitations include:
- Wedding date
- Venue details
- Event timings
- RSVP information
Send invitations early so guests can plan their travel and availability.
One Month Before the Wedding: Final Preparations
The final month is about confirming details and making sure everything is ready.
Complete tasks such as:
- Confirming vendors
- Final outfit fittings
- Reviewing guest list
- Preparing payments
- Checking décor plans
- Finalizing ceremony details
Create a checklist of pending tasks so nothing gets missed.
Wedding Week Checklist
During the wedding week, focus on coordination and enjoying the celebration.
Confirm:
- Venue arrangements
- Vendor timings
- Guest arrivals
- Transportation plans
- Photography schedule
Prepare an emergency kit with essentials like safety pins, medicines, makeup products, and other small items that may be needed.
Assign responsibilities to trusted family members or hire a wedding planner to handle coordination.
Wedding Day Checklist
On the big day, the most important thing is to enjoy every moment.
Make sure:
- Venue setup is completed on time
- Vendors are coordinated
- Guests are welcomed properly
- Important ceremonies happen according to schedule
- Photography moments are planned
Having someone manage logistics allows the couple and family to focus on celebrating.
Post-Wedding Tasks
After the wedding celebrations, complete important follow-up tasks:
- Collect wedding photos and videos
- Complete pending payments
- Send thank-you messages
- Preserve wedding outfits
- Share memories with loved ones
These small steps help you wrap up the wedding experience smoothly.

FAQs
1. How early should couples start planning their wedding?
Ideally, couples should start planning 10–12 months before the wedding, especially if they want popular venues and vendors.
2. What is the first step in wedding planning?
The first step is deciding your wedding vision, setting a budget, and finalizing an approximate guest list.
3. When should I book my wedding venue?
It is recommended to book your wedding venue 8–12 months before the wedding, especially during peak wedding seasons.
4. Which wedding vendors should be booked first?
The venue, photographer, caterer, decorator, and makeup artist should be booked early as they often have limited availability.
